Robert Warren “Bob” Scherbarth, 69 years old, entered heaven to enjoy eternal life after his untimely death on November 18, 2020.
Bob was able to give the gift of life to others by being an organ donor preceding his final passing, showing once again, in life and in death; Bob was a most generous and caring man.
Bob was born January 5th, 1951 in Torrington, WY to Warren & Betty (Glee) Scherbarth. He grew up in Hay Springs, NE, and graduated from Hay Springs High School.
After graduation he worked for a neighboring farm, then enlisted in the United States Army, serving his country admirably for four years. After his honorable discharge he worked road construction, then as a Carman – most recently for Progress Rail, from which he retired.
On May 28, 1988 in Alliance, NE, he married the love of his life, Nancy (Barth) Scherbarth. During their 32 years of marriage they served the Lord through activities at Immanuel Lutheran Church as well as their community.
They raised their daughter, Bridget Hudson, and in recent years have enjoyed the pleasure of spoiling their grandchildren, Tavin and Teagan Hudson. Bob also enjoyed his hobbies of guns, reading history, and being a faithful servant, husband, father, and grandfather.
